Key Issues in International Commercial and Treaty Arbitration: 2019

Friday, November 22, 2019
9 a.m. – 6 p.m.

Keynote Address:
Julian D M Lew QC
Transparency in International Arbitration: Practical Value or Voyeurism?

20 Essex Street Chambers, Head of the School of International Arbitration, Centre for Commercial Law Studies, Queen Mary University of London

Conversation with Meg Kinnear
Secretary-General of the International Centre for Settlement of Investment Disputes (ICSID), on the amendment of the ICSID ICSID Rules

Moderated by Donald Donovan, Debevoise & Plimpton LLP


The conference stellar speakers will also address:

  • What Are Global Arbitral Institutions Focusing on Today?
  • Hot Tubbing Experts: Examining the Process
  • Contract Interpretation in International Arbitration: Is There a Common Law-Civil Law Divide that Matters?
  • Economic Issues in International Arbitration: A Primer
